John Wayne Casserole

Description

A hearty casserole with seasoned ground beef, cheese, and a comforting biscuit crust that is perfect for busy weeknights.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 pounds ground beef (browned and drained)
  • 1 ounce packet taco seasoning
  • 16 ounce can large biscuits
  • 1/2 cup sour cream
  • 1/2 cup mayonnaise
  • 8 ounces cheddar cheese (shredded and divided)
  • 1 medium onion (halved and sliced)
  • 2 medium tomatoes (sliced)
  • 1 medium red bell pepper (halved and sliced)
  • 4 ounces canned sliced jalapeño peppers (optional)
  • Salt and black pepper to taste
  • 1 tablespoon vegetable oil
  • Chopped cilantro or green onion for garnish (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F and prepare a 13×9 glass baking dish with nonstick spray.
  2. Arrange biscuits in the pan and press to form a crust.
  3. Bake the biscuit crust for 12 to 15 minutes until light brown.
  4. In a skillet, heat vegetable oil and sauté onions until translucent.
  5. Add ground beef and brown, draining excess fat.
  6. Stir in taco seasoning and water, simmer until reduced.
  7. In a bowl, mix sour cream, mayonnaise, half of the cheddar, and reserved onions.
  8. Sauté remaining onions with red bell pepper until softened.
  9. Layer the casserole: beef, tomatoes, onion and pepper mixture, jalapeños, sour cream mixture, and top with remaining cheddar.
  10. Bake uncovered for 30 to 40 minutes until edges are browned and cheese is bubbling.
  11. Let rest for 8 to 10 minutes before slicing.

Notes

For best results, let the casserole cool slightly before serving. Can be paired with a salad for a lighter meal.
